Vodafone adds loyalty cards to its mobile wallet app... but still no UK launch

Vodafone is enabling customers to add loyalty cards and membership cards to its ‘mobile wallet’ app. Although the application hasn’t yet been launched in the UK, it’s already available in a number of European countries.

The NFC-equipped Vodafone Wallet - and its associated Visa-powered Vodafone SmartPass mobile payment app - was launched in Spain last November.

Customers can now load supermarket loyalty cards, paper coupons and other membership documents into the app as well, thanks to a deal with Austrian software company Bluesource. This new service will be rolled out to Germany, the Netherlands and Spain this month. Over a million people have already downloaded the original Bluesource mobile-pocket app.

Stefano Parisse, Group Consumer Services Director of Vodafone, said “Our customers want to take advantage of as many club, retail and membership offers as possible, but the number of plastic cards often exceed the capacity of their physical wallets. Vodafone’s mobile wallet, when used with the mobile pocket app, removes that problem by allowing a user to load a limitless number of loyalty cards directly onto their phone. Participating retailers also benefit since they will be able to send vouchers and special offers directly to the Vodafone mobile wallets of their regular customers.”

A UK release of the Vodafone wallet is expected soon; the company had originally promised UK availability by Spring 2014.


UPDATE: Vodafone has contacted us to advise that it’s no longer talking about a spring launch for the UK. Instead, the Vodafone wallet is described as “coming to the UK later this year”.
